Our beloved son,
Andrew Perry WELDON Hogue, lost his fight with cancer and died on the
morning of June 9th at the age of 37 leaving
his bereft parents Blane Hogue and Isobel Weldon Hogue and his much
loved sister Clare in Australia. He will also be greatly missed by his
dear friend Lucie Aounetse in Moncton.
Weldon was born in
Calgary Alberta on August 25, 1988 and grew up with so many lifelong
friends in Elbow Park and Marda Loop. After
graduation from Western Canada High School he went to University of
Lethbridge where again he made lifelong friends. He later moved to
Vancouver where he studied at Vancouver Community College and started
his career as a highly accomplished barber/stylist. He travelled
extensively throughout Canada and the U.S. and went twice to Japan and
several times to his father Blane’s homeland of
Australia where there are many grieving cousins, uncles and aunts. He
went with his parents almost every year since he was a baby to his
mother Isobel’s birthplace in New Brunswick and
spent time in the summer with family in Shediac and Moncton. In 2023
he moved permanently to Moncton where Blane and Isobel had moved to in
2019. There he worked first at the great Rock and Razors Barbershop
and then with the amazing team at Handsome Devils
Barbershop.
